What's there to see and do in Turangi?
Take in some sights and attractions while you’re in Turangi by visiting Lake Taupo, Tokaanu Thermal Pools, and Tongariro Alpine Crossing. If you have extra time while you’re in the area, you might want to see Mount Tongariro and Tongariro National Park.
